DCS 系列概述
DCS 系列的 1 kW、1.2 kW 和 3 kW 程控电源均采用独特的封装技术,可在额定输出电压和电流范围内的任何电压/电流组合条件下,持续供应满输出功率(1 kW,1.2 kW 或 3 kW)。其外型虽然轻巧,但电源供应可靠性高,可长时间连续使用。
DCS 电源系列具有易于使用的前面板和 10-转电位计,可对同时显示的电压和电流设置进行调节。 LED 指示灯显示过温、远程编程、关闭和过压保护,以及状态和恒定电压/电流模式操作。 DCS 3 kW 型号能提供输出待机模式的按钮控制、OVP 复位,远程/本地编程,以及电压、电流和 OVP 设定点的状态预览等功能。
Sorensen DCS 系列产品也可以远程控制。 该系列产品其具备标准的四种模拟控制模式以及隔离模拟控制功能(选项)。DCS 也通过 IEEE488.2 GPIB(选件)或符合 LXI 标准的以太网(选件)实现计算机控制。
主要特点与优势:
宽广的电压范围
直流电压水平从 0-8 V 到 0-600 V;电流水平从 1.7 A 到 350 A
供两个设备使用的主/从并行电缆
5 年质保
远程编程
- 可选择的电压、电流和 OVP 远程编程
- 可通过符合 LXI 标准的以太网 LAN/RS-232C(M130)进行 16 位编程
- 可通过 IEEE-488.2/RS-232C(M9C 选件)进行 12 位隔离模拟程控(选件 M51)
- 多通道从接口(M85 或 M131 选件)
软件
- 适用于 M130 选件的 IVI-com 驱动程序
- 用于 M9C 选件 的 Labwindows CVI 驱动程序
- 用于 M9C 选件的 Labview 驱动程序

Sorensen DCS 系列规格
Common Meter Accuracy 1% of full scale + 1 count Max. Voltage Differential from Output to Safety Ground 150 VDC Remote Start/Stop and Interlock TTL compatible input or 12-250 VAC (12-130 VDC) or a contact closure Cooling Internal fan, over temperature shutdown if internal heat sink exceeds set temperature Remote Sense The maximum allowed sense line drop is 4V per line (2V on the DCS 8/10V 1 kW/1.2 kW models and 1V/line for all 3 kW models). Line drop subtracts from the maximum available output voltage at full rated power. Remote Programming Enabled via external jumper on rear panel connector J3 Overvoltage Protection Crowbar type adjustable from 5-110% of rated output using front panel control (local or remote program selectable via J3 jumper) Remote Analog Programming Linearity Typical error is less an 0.5% setting.
